Prosperous vs. Weakened: Equal depth of feeling, two different faces
The glow of the Tai Yin star changes with the palace it occupies, and this is especially evident in the Parents Palace. Tai Yin in the Parents Palace in strong positions (hai, zi, or chou palace) means the mother is intelligent, beautiful, and financially capable, willing to invest heart and mind in her children. The mother in the zi palace carries an artistic quality. While the hai palace's 'moon brightening at the heavenly gate' gives the mother especially outstanding vision and perspective. Those of this type receive ample maternal love from childhood, with stable security, making them less prone to anxiety in emotional relationships in adulthood.
The situation in weak positions (mao, chen, or si palace) is different: the mother may have a weaker constitution, or may be more occupied with making a living, with greater emotional fluctuations. However, a weak position does not equal 'emotional distance'. Quite the opposite. These people often develop an even deeper emotional bond with their mother precisely because they worry about her and are accustomed to caring for her. Tai Yin in positions without moonlight (wu, wei, or shen palace) tends toward few opportunities for togetherness: the mother is intelligent, but physical or psychological distance shortens the time spent together.

Read the Four Transformations: Nourishment or Entanglement?
The four transformations are the key data for judging the direction of auspiciousness and misfortune for Tai Yin in the Parents Palace. Tai Yin with Lu in the Parents Palace means the wealth treasury is full and maternal love overflows. The mother is generous materially and actively giving emotionally. This is the most ideal configuration. Tai Yin with Ke means the mother values reputation and decorum. The family education leans toward etiquette and image, with a profound cultural influence on children. Tai Yin with Ji is a signal that requires attention: the mother's health may show warning signs, and emotional manipulation or mother-in-law tensions can easily arise. Ji does not mean thin affinity — rather, it is a reminder that this deep love needs a more conscious cultivation of boundaries.
